Key Objectives
- Assume sole responsibility for assigned Instrument and Controls engineering work scopes.
- Carry out Instrument and Controls discipline work within a project team, supporting the project team for field development of oil and gas production facilities.
- Plan, budget, organize and control a segment of the Instrument and Controls engineering deliverables for the project.
- Prepare Instrument and Controls deliverables for all project phases in the oil and gas industry.
- Ensure that all work is completed without compromise to quality and is delivered according to the project schedule.
- Provide direction and guidance on all Instrument and Controls engineering technical queries raised by either internal or external parties.
- Liaise with the Client's Engineering, Operations and Maintenance staff as required to ensure a consistent approach to project completion.
- Promote safe behaviour at all times.
- Provide sound technical advice and solutions to a diversity of technical problems within the discipline.
- Co-ordinate with other disciplines during all stages of design development, construction, pre-commissioning, and start-up.
- Assist in the coordination of all activities related to Instrument and Controls engineering design.
- Identify any areas of concern with respect to progress and/or quality and recommend corrective actions as required.

Expected:
- Degree qualification in Instrument or Electronics Engineering.
- Minimum of 15 years experience in the oil and gas industry.
- Minimum of 5 years proven capability in an engineering design company.
- Knowledge and understanding of the fundamentals of Instrument and Controls engineering design and analysis.
- Familiar with the typical software packages that are used for Instrument and Controls engineering design.
- Experience of the application of HAZOP, HAZID and SIL Rating to Instrument and Controls design.
- Experience with FEED studies.
- Experience of working with multi-national and multi-cultural project teams is strongly preferred.
- Fluent in both spoken and written English language.
- Candidates must be willing to travel to Basra, Iraq.
